I rec'd my 650 today (gotta love the brown truck). However I have never owned any type of palm device. Is the device "always" on?
What I mean is if you hold the red power key it seems to turn the phone function on and off. My question is how do you turn the actual device off. If you can't turn the device off, isn't this going to be a power drain. When I would charge a cell phone, I would turn it off. If this device remains always"on", should I at least turn the phone function off when I charge? TIA for your replys helping a newbie!

NoClones
11-19-2004, 06:37 PM
It's always on... The screen is the only thing you can turn on and off. But it goes off by itself after a set time anyway.

Mine is coming tomorrow. I printed the manual and on page 28 it says to press the power/end key to turn the phone on or off.

On page 33 & 34 it says the same to turn the screen on or off.

When you press the power/end key how do you know if you are turning the phone or the screen on or off? :confused:

thomasanderson
11-23-2004, 09:26 AM
When you tap the button, the screen goes off, and thats it. When you hold the button down, you get an animation and a series of graphics that inform you that wireless mode is turned off.

This was less confusing on the 600, because there were two seperate buttons for each function.
